Tropical Depression Seven forms in Atlantic, likely to become Tropical Storm Fiona soon

Tropical Depression Seven forms in Atlantic, likely to become Tropical Storm Fiona soon


Tropical Depression Seven formed Wednesday in Atlantic Ocean. It's forecast to strengthen into Tropical Storm Fiona as it heads toward Puerto Rico

Full Article